Off to Islay

Finally.... after a break of 14 months, way too long but that was because of a lovely wee girl who became one year old today, we are finally on our way to Islay and hope to arrive there on the afternoon ferry on Saturday the 1st of May. We are staying three weeks on the island, at Persabus, and look forward to meet up with friends, enjoy the quiet life and we will also try to make several trips over to Jura and Colonsay. This also means that I won't update this blog for a while but I have found a nice alternative to keep you up to date, providing everything works out as I have planned. Fingers crossed....


Ferry arrival at Port Ellen

From Saturday onwards I will try to post daily images on a new type of blogging service called Posterous. I had seen Armin using it when he was on Islay during the walk week and it's a nice way to keep you all up-to-date. Why Posterous? I can update it from my phone. I simply send out an email to my Posterous account, attach images or video and Posterous will automatically make a blog post, update Facebook, add images to my Flickr account and sends out a tweet. Now this makes life easy hence my attempt to use it. Now before images from Jura end up on the Islay account and vice versa I have created three accounts, one for Scotland, one for Jura and one for Islay. This should hopefully give you an idea of our whereabouts. All the best for now and I will hopefully be back to blogging here around the 25th of May.
